Physical activity improves psychological wellbeing, reduces clinical depression risk, and has a beneficial effect on anxiety.

Regular physical activity is a proven way to improve your mental health. It reduces the risk of clinical depression, helps with anxiety, and boosts mood and self-esteem. Incorporate activity into your routine to support your psychological wellbeing.

There is good evidence that physical inactivity increases the risk of clinical depression. There is also good evidence that physical activity has an important beneficial effect on anxiety. Furthermore, physical activity is important for psychological wellbeing and can be used as a means to improve mood and self-esteem.
Lisa M Miles · Nutrition Bulletin · 2007
